Harrah’s Hoosier Park Racing & Casino reaches record handle

Anderson, IN — Just seven nights into the 2021 live harness racing season, Harrah’s Hoosier Park Racing & Casino recorded the largest Thursday night handle ever in the 27-year history of the track on April 8. Bolstered by full fields and competitive racing, the evening’s 13-race card produced a total of $1,151,829 wagered.

“We’d like to send a very big thank you to everyone who watched and wagered on tonight’s card at Harrah’s Hoosier Park,” Vice President and General Manager of Racing, Rick Moore, noted. “We are firm believers in momentum, and this is a great way to start the season. We’d also like to thank the horsemen for putting on an outstanding show each and every night.”

Harrah’s Hoosier Park kicked off the 2021 live racing season on March 26 and did it with a bang as the bettors came out in full force. Handle increases were felt both on track and through export wagering to produce $703,202 in all sources handle for the evening. All sources handle was up an impressive 7.5 percent over opening night in 2019 with the same number of races carded.

Live racing will return to Harrah’s Hoosier Park on Friday (April 9) with an action packed 13-race card. Friday’s card will feature a $20,000 Open Pace and four divisions of the Jerry Landess Memorial Pacing Series. Friday’s card will also feature a $10,000 guaranteed Hoosier High-5 pool in the last race of the program.

With a daily post time of 6:30 p.m., Harrah’s Hoosier Park’s 2021 season will feature 160 live racing days. Racing will be held on a Wednesday through Saturday schedule through mid-May before adding Sunday evenings. The full schedule continues through September before dropping back down to a Wednesday through Saturday schedule through Dec. 4. For the first time ever, Harrah’s Hoosier Park will also offer live racing on both the night before Thanksgiving and Thanksgiving night.
